M.D.S.A. Perera vs Dharmasena Dissanayake – SC FR/APPLICATION NO. 62/2020-2023
In the case between M.D.S.A. Perera and the Public Service Commission (with its Chairman and Members) along with other associated government officials and agencies, the court addressed the issue of an alleged violation of the petitioner’s fundamental right to equality under Article 12(1) of the Constitution. It was held that the initiation and conduct of disciplinary proceedings against the petitioner, particularly on the verge of his retirement, were procedurally irregular and constituted an unlawful exercise of authority.
